Output 2a26fa884222d61ba626dac0b5baab670f2a2fc28176880ccc32ab5bbf6d6e1e:1

value
1301498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 115817a0fddf7b89ae896dce219193cd7cedf084 OP_EQUAL
address
33GiwZjanYCaL1JyABVn7VSedZnr9Y8P6L
transaction
2a26fa884222d61ba626dac0b5baab670f2a2fc28176880ccc32ab5bbf6d6e1e
confirmations
378549
spent
true